四丁基溴化铵催化合成环氧大豆油

             

摘要

在无溶剂无羧酸条件下,以四丁基溴化铵为相转移催化剂,用65%的叔丁基过氧化氢(TBHP)为氧源直接合成环氧大豆油.考察了反应温度、反应时间、催化剂用量及TBHP与碳碳双键摩尔比对环氧化反应的影响,通过红外光谱对催化环氧化的机理进行了初步探究.结果表明:在反应温度65℃、反应时间3h、催化剂用量3.0g(10.0 g大豆油)、TBHP与碳碳双键摩尔比1.5∶1条件下,催化环氧化效果最好,环氧值、转化率和选择性分别达到3.5%、53.9%和77.5%.此方法操作简单,催化剂价格低,简化了工艺流程,降低了工艺成本,同时克服了传统方法使用羧酸和溶剂等造成的弊端.%In the absence of solvent and carboxylic acid,epoxy soybean oil was synthesized with tetrabutylammonium bromide as phase transfer catalyst and TBHP (65%) as oxygen source.The effects of reaction time,reaction temperature,dosage of catalyst and molar ratio of TBHP to carbon-carbon double bond on the epoxy reaction were investigated,and the reaction mechanism was analyzed by FTIR.The results showed that the optimal reaction conditions were obtained as follows:reaction temperature 65 ℃,reaction time 3 h,dosage of catalyst 3.0 g(soybean oil mass 10.0 g),molar ratio of TBHP to carboncarbon double bond 1.5∶ 1.Under the optimal conditions,the catalytic epoxy result was the best,and the epoxy value of the product,conversion and selectivity could reach 3.5%,53.9% and 77.5%,respectively.The method had the items of simply process,easy operation and low cost,and it overcame the drawbacks of the traditional methods of using carboxylic acids and solvents.
